Ohio Candidate Sees Economic Plus In James' Return

Ohio's Democratic candidate for governor says LeBron James' return to Cleveland boosts more than the Cavaliers' title chances.
 
Ed FitzGerald is the chief executive of Cuyahoga County, which includes Cleveland, and was visiting Cincinnati on Friday. FitzGerald says after James left for Miami four years ago, it hit Cuyahoga County's revenues because of reduced attendance and downtown activities.
 
He says James' return, announced Friday, is good news not only for Cavaliers fans but for area businesses and the taxpayers. FitzGerald says it also keeps Cleveland's momentum going, with James' decision coming days after the announcement of plans to hold the 2016 Republican National Convention in Cleveland.
 
Meanwhile, a spokesman for Republican Gov. John Kasich says it's more great news for both Cleveland and Ohio job creation.
